What was recalled
The U.S. Consumer Product Safety Commission (CPSC) has issued a recall for a specific piece of home audio equipment manufactured by Russound. The product in question is the MCA-88 Multizone Controller Amplifier. This is not a generic or minor accessory; it is a substantial, high-capacity device designed to manage distributed audio systems throughout a home. If you have installed this unit to control music across multiple rooms, it is critical that you verify whether your specific model falls under this safety notice. The recall targets units that provide up to eight distinct zones of audio output, making them popular choices for whole-house sound installations where different songs or volumes are needed in separate areas.
To identify if you own the recalled item, you must look closely at the physical characteristics of your amplifier. The affected models measure approximately 17 inches wide by 3.5 inches high by 17.2 inches deep and weigh about 28.8 pounds. The brand name "Russound" is printed clearly on the front of the housing, and the model number MCA-88 is also located on the front. However, the most definitive way to confirm if your unit is part of this recall is by checking the serial number. You will find the serial number on a visible label on the front of the unit, located under the clear plastic cover. The recall applies specifically to units with serial numbers that begin with four digits ranging from 2047 through 2307.

What to do — step by step
If you own a Russound MCA-88 Multizone Controller Amplifier, the most important thing you can do right now is prioritize safety over convenience. The recall notice from the Consumer Product Safety Commission (CPSC) identifies a serious fire hazard caused by internal circuit board components that can overheat. Because this is an electrical device plugged into your home’s power system, ignoring the issue or continuing to use it even intermittently is not a viable option. Here is exactly how to handle this situation calmly and effectively, based on the remedy provided by Russound. First, immediately stop using the recalled amplifier. This means turning off any audio system that includes this unit and unplugging it from the wall outlet. Do not attempt to diagnose the problem yourself by opening the case or testing the internal components. The hazard is internal and specific to the manufacturing defect; accessing the internals voids safety protocols and puts you at risk of electrical shock or further damage. Simply disconnecting the power removes the energy source that could potentially trigger the overheating issue, leaving the device in a safe, inactive state while you arrange for its replacement. Next, you need to contact Russound to initiate the remedy process. The company has agreed to provide a free replacement unit, but there is a crucial detail here: the new unit will be installed by a certified professional installer at no cost to you. This is a significant benefit because it removes the burden of technical installation from your shoulders and ensures the new equipment is set up correctly for safety and performance. To get started, you have three convenient options for reaching their support team. You can call them directly at 800-638-8055 between 8:30 a.m. and 5 p.m. Eastern Time, Monday through Friday. Alternatively, you may send an email to recall@russound.com with your issue details. For those who prefer digital navigation, visit https://russound.com/MCA88 or go to the main site at https://russound.com and click on the "Product Recalls" section to find specific instructions and forms. When you contact Russound, be prepared to provide your unit’s serial number. As noted in the recall description, this number is located on a visible label on the front of the unit, underneath the clear plastic cover. It begins with four digits ranging from 2047 through 2307. Having this information ready will speed up the verification process and confirm that your specific device is part of the affected batch. Once your eligibility is confirmed, Russound will coordinate with a certified professional to schedule the installation of your free replacement. Staying safe: broader tips
While this specific recall addresses a manufacturing defect in the Russound MCA-88 amplifier, the underlying hazard—electrical components overheating due to internal failures—is a risk that applies to all high-power audio equipment. Understanding how these devices operate and where they typically fail can help you prevent similar incidents with any brand or model you own. The primary cause of such fires is often not just a bad component, but the environment in which the amplifier sits. Amplifiers generate significant heat during operation, especially when driving multiple zones at high volumes for extended periods. If this heat cannot dissipate properly, it can degrade internal components faster than intended, eventually leading to short circuits or thermal runaway.
To mitigate these risks generally, always ensure your audio equipment has adequate ventilation. Never stack other devices directly on top of an amplifier, and avoid placing it in enclosed cabinets without proper airflow gaps. The unit should have at least a few inches of clearance on all sides, particularly around the vents or heat sinks. If you are installing a multizone system similar to the one recalled, consider having a professional evaluate the placement of your rack or cabinet to ensure fans are working correctly and dust is not blocking airways. Dust accumulation acts as an insulator, trapping heat inside the chassis and raising the internal temperature well beyond safe operating limits.
Regular visual and auditory inspections are another simple but powerful defense. Periodically check for signs of wear on power cords, unusual burning smells, or changes in sound quality that might indicate a failing capacitor or transformer. If your amplifier ever feels unusually hot to the touch or emits any odor resembling burning plastic, unplug it immediately and allow it to cool before investigating further. Do not attempt to open the unit yourself unless you are a qualified technician; internal components can hold a charge even after being unplugged.
